Neither you nor the OP have given direct evidence on the matter, and it is presumptuous to think that the narrative you presented trumps the OP's vague reference to twin studies. A quick google study yields "Using 15 years of data on Finnish twins, we find that 24% (54%) of the variance of women’s (men’s) lifetime income is due to genetic factors and that the contribution of the shared environment is negligible."[0] But I don't want to claim this is the final word, it's just the kind of evidence that is useful rather than blithe assertions and name calling.
